Ending The Cycle Of Abuse Summary

Ending The Cycle Of Abuse: The Stories Of Women Abused As Children & The Group Therapy Techniques That Helped Them Heal by Philip G. Ney

First published in 1995. Routledge is an imprint of Taylor & Francis, an informa company.

Table of Contents

Why Child Abuse and Neglect Becomes Transgenerational; How This Group Treatment Works. Realization: Knowing and Feeling What Happened to Me. Anna's Description; Tanya's Story. Protest: Expressing the Anger and Fear. Guilt: Dealing with Their Responsibility and Mine. Despair: Saying Goodbye to What Might Have Been or Could be. Relationships: Determining What Are Realistic Expectations. Reconciliation: Direct Negotiations for Compensation and Forgiveness. Rehabilitation: Using My Bad Experiences for the Benefit of Others Lisa's Story. Rejoice: Accepting the Fascinating Fullness of Life.
